Overview of Swinging

  • Swinging involves couples opening up their relationship to include other partners, primarily for physical connections.
  • Differentiates from polyamory where multiple emotional relationships are formed.
  • Seen as a method to reinvigorate relationships by introducing physical novelty.

Historical Context

  • Early swinging reported among WWII Air Force pilots as a bonding ritual.
  • Swinging was normalized during the Vietnam War and became widespread during the 1960s' free love movement.

Terminology

  • Play: Physical interactions between swingers and their partners.
  • Soft Swap: Trading partners without full intercourse.
  • Full Swap: Full sexual interactions with partners.
  • Closed Door Swinging: Swinging in separate rooms.
  • Open Door Swinging: Swinging in the same room.
  • Hot Wife and Cuckolding: A married woman swings with consent, and the husband may participate as an observer for humiliation.
  • Bareback: Sexual activity without a condom.
  • D&D Free: Free of diseases and drugs.
  • Parallel Play: Couples having sex in the same room without swapping.
  • Unicorn: A single female sought after at swinger parties.

Challenges and Benefits

  • Swinging can add excitement and reinvigorate relationships.
  • Trust and communication are essential.
  • Jealousy is a significant risk, potentially leading to relationship issues.
